Structure of the IELTS Speaking Test
The [IELTS Listening Practice Online Saudi Arabia](https://hackmd.okfn.de/s/HyvSI99rWl) Speaking Test is divided into three parts:
PartPeriodDescriptionPart 1: Introduction and Interview4-5 minutesThe examiner presents themselves and asks the prospect to introduce themselves and supply some basic information about their life, interests, and background.Part 2: Long Turn3-4 minutesThe prospect is provided a job card with a topic, which they require to discuss for 1-2 minutes. They have one minute to prepare their reaction.Part 3: Two-Way Discussion4-5 minutesThe examiner engages the prospect in a conversation that is more abstract and linked to the subject from Part 2.
By comprehending the structure, candidates can much better prepare and feel more comfy during the test.

How is the IELTS Speaking Test graded?
The [IELTS Preparation Material Free Download Saudi Arabia](https://md.swk-web.com/s/__KPtHf4e) Speaking Test is graded on four criteria: fluency and coherence, lexical resource, grammatical range and precision, and pronunciation.
2. Can I use notes throughout the Speaking Test?
No, candidates are not enabled to use notes or any other aids throughout the Speaking Test.
3. What should I do if I do not understand a question?
If you do not comprehend a question, it is completely acceptable to ask the examiner to repeat or clarify it.
4. How long is the Speaking Test?
The Speaking Test generally lasts in between 11 to 14 minutes.
